Rated on Jun 27, 2023 Published on Jun 27 ...The Bloomberg US Universal Index represents the union of the US Aggregate Index, US Corporate High Yield Index, Investment Grade 144A Index, Eurodollar Index, US Emerging Markets Index, and the non-ERISA eligible portion of the CMBS Index. The index covers USD-denominated, taxable bonds that are rated either investment grade or high -yield.Increase yield and reduce risk through diversification Allocating to non-core sectors may help investors increase yield, but higher yield often comes with higher risk and higher correlation to equities. Portfolio Managers. 1,2.The ACF Yield is the discount rate that equates the ETF's aggregate cash flows (i.e., the sum of the cash flows of the ETF's holdings) to a given ETF price. The cash flows are based on the yield to worst methodology in which a bond's cash flows are assumed to occur at the call date (if applicable) or maturity, whichever results in the …Mar 21, 2023 · To provide a framework for this assessment, we highlight five key bond valuation metrics below. 1. If you have the dollar price, you can solve for the yield-to-maturi...Yield: 3.19%: YTD Daily Total Return: 2.78%: Beta (5Y Monthly) 1.00: Expense Ratio (net) 0.03%: Inception Date: 2003-09-22Since the Agg’s inception, 88% of the rolling 5-year total returns can be attributed to the starting yield alone. Also, 61% of the time, total return deviated from the starting yield by less than +/-1%. Lastly, the Agg is solely comprised of investment grade securities and default risk within the index is very low.Vanguard funds not held in a brokerage account are held by The Vanguard Group, Inc., and are not protected by SIPC. About Bloomberg US Agg Credit Yield To Worst. >>> If you have any questions about this index, please read {LPHP IN:0:1 4005900 <GO>} or ...Let’s use the yield to maturity (YTM) of the US Bloomberg Aggregate Index (the “Agg”) as an example. At a high level, YTM is the annual total return anticipated on a fixed income portfolio if all the bonds within the portfolio were held until the end of their lifetime (maturity).
